Career/Work Experience
Volunteer work experience in approved community agencies and organizations. Helps relate academic interests to real-life situations. One hour seminar weekly, plus a minimum of 45 hours of designated work per credit. Maximum of 12 credits allowed, with 6 credits per semester. Prerequisites: None.

MCCCD Official Course Competencies:
 
CWE198AC   19962-19965 Career/Work Experience
1. Assess one's personality, interests, values, motivation, skills, and priorities as they relate to the world of work. (I)
2. Establish career goals. (I)
3. Describe how to conduct an effective job search. (I)
4. Write a resume. (I)
5. Interview effectively. (I)
6. Participate in a volunteer work experience. (II)
7. Demonstrate an increased understanding of own field of interest. (II)
8. Gain skill and experience from working in own field of interest. (II)
